What Pirates and Gangsta Rappers Have in Common:
As a student of both Black Studies & Rap Culture, and Pirate Culture, I have conducted in depth studies of these two groups. The results of this research have led me to compile a list of commonalities between these two groups, which can be found below.
Pirates and Gansta Rappers Have the Following in Common:
- Fixation on gold and jewelry
- Injuries and harm to one's body sustained in conflict translate directly into status.
- Strong aversion to the authorities.
- Love of booty
- Song and lyric that glorify past exploits.
- Use of the word "yo!" (as in 'yo-ho-ho and a bottle of rum' and 'yo whaddup?')
- Insistence on use of nickname and aliases.
- Healthy affinity for eye-patches
- Intense interest in boats
- High tolerance for promiscuous women.
- Healthy respect for individuals wielding hooks in lieu of hand
- Love of drink, especially rum (with or without the accompaniment of coke)
- Always travel with a crew.
